Output 31403a63f549242a42c38ceb7e3e56342d614dd57bbcac612a7b05d02f9131d7:1

value
654036
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 890b4f29756aaccb750acbf5eaad0e260c2071fc2f14cd1567849861ea4ae68f
address
bc1p3y9572t4d2kvkag2e0674tgwycxzqu0u9u2v69t8sjvxr6j2u68s7uj7zt
transaction
31403a63f549242a42c38ceb7e3e56342d614dd57bbcac612a7b05d02f9131d7
spent
true